What I Look For Before Buying
Before I buy any electrolyte mix, I always check a few things:
- Electrolyte balance: I want a product with enough sodium, potassium, and magnesium to actually support hydration.
- Ingredients: I prefer clean formulas without unnecessary fillers or sugar.
- Taste: If I don’t enjoy drinking it, I won’t use it consistently.
- Mixability: I want it to dissolve easily in water without clumping.
- Use case: I consider whether I need it for workouts, fasting, travel, or daily hydration.

Things I’d Consider Before Buying
Even though I like LMNT, I think it’s important to be realistic before buying:
- Higher sodium: I would not choose it if I needed a low-sodium option.
- Taste preference: If I dislike salty drinks, I might not enjoy it.
- Price: I usually compare cost per serving before committing.
- Purpose: I make sure I actually need electrolyte replacement, not just flavored water.
